I have created a general task list in which 2 operations i have taken as PM03 (external services), I assigned cost element , material group and sales organisation to both of my operations and saved it.
Now I want to edit my task list (IA06) and replace control key as PM01 (Internal operation) in place of PM03, but control key field is in read only mode.
My issue is how to edit control key.
Hint : I know 1 answer that delete operation and add new operation with desired control key but I am not satisfied. Please share your ideas if any one have some new solution. Please explain what is logic due to which control key field is going in read only mode.

If you do delete the operation, and re-create it as line 0020, you can change this operation's number to 0010 afterwards, with the result that it will appear as if you've edited operation 0010.

You will not be able to edit the control key. For a PM03 operation (standard configuration with external service) a service line must be added. The use may have added many service lines with related data values. Allowing the key to be changed easily would wipe out that data. For that reason the control key is greyed out and cannot be changed.
The only option is to delete and replace.
